Emily Blunt And John Krasinski Engaged

jk-eb-lead1
John Krasinski is living the perfect Hollywood life. He is so beloved as Jim on “The Office” that people are more interested in his on-screen romance with Pam (played by Jenna Fischer) than his real life romance — not an easy thing to accomplish under the watchful eye of the media. That explains how he was able to keep his relationship with The Devil Wears Prada star Emily Blunt so under the radar. The couple have been dating since November 2008 and have now confirmed that they recently got engaged. (We actually weren’t even aware that they were an item — good work, you stealthy kids!). We’re sure a few nerdy girls will shed a tear for the loss of one of Must-See TV’s cutest bachelors, that’s for sure.

Blunt had previously dated singer Michael Bublé and Krasinski had been linked to former co-star Rashida Jones. No details of a wedding have been released. [Source: People; Photo: Getty Images]

Interview: Jason Segel Wants A Man Date With Barack Obama

Jason Segel, who made a name for himself by starring on Judd Apatow’s cult TV hit Freaks & Geeks, has the same laid-back, California vibe that he exudes in Forgetting Sarah Marshall. He also has a razor-sharp wit. Maybe this is why he seems like a natural fit to co-star as Paul Rudd’s new Best Dude Forever in I Love You, Man — an exploration of male friendship that opens tomorrow (March 20). We spoke with Jason about the real-life nature of his man friends, whether he’s a “girlfriend guy” or a “guy’s guy” and what Hollywood hunk he’d most like to have a man date with. Answer: The First African-American President of the United States is more his type.

Scandalist: I Love You, Man has a hilarious cast, including you, Paul Rudd, Andy Samberg, Rashida Jones, Jon Favreau and Jaime Pressly. Which one of you was the “class clown” while filming the movie?

Jason Segel: I’d have to say Andy. Andy Samberg. He’s hilarious from the moment he arrives on set, which is 6 a.m., to the moment he leaves. But there was this one moment … Forgetting Sarah Marshall had just come out when they began filming I Love You, Man, and I was feeling a little down because Forbidden Kingdom had beat it by $1 million. A woman approached me on the way to set, and said: “I just need to tell you I saw the movie this weekend and I loved it.” When she walked away, Andy turned to me and said, “She thinks you’re Jet Li.”
